Weber State drops home opener to Sac State

9/24/2016 4:25:00 AM | Women's Volleyball

OGDEN — Weber State volleyball team dropped their first match of the season to Sacramento State in four sets Friday night for the first loss on the season. 

"Tonight was the worst match we've played all season long," said head Coach Jeremiah Larsen. "Hats off to Sac State who played consistent volleyball. We made several uncharacteristic errors that we haven't made before tonight. We always say in our gym, 'we never win, we never lose but we always learn.' Hopefully we learned something about ourselves tonight and we can make sure it never happens again."

The two teams started off the first set with a neck and neck battle and a tie score at 11-11.   Late in the first set the Wildcats had a 21-18 lead and the final two points of the match came from a kill by Amanda Varley and a big block by Megan Thompson and Varley to solidify the Wildcats 25-21 first set victory.

Sac State came out firing in the second set and claimed an early 12-5 lead. The Hornets went on to end the second set on an 8-1 to one run that gave them a 25-14 second set win. The overall match score was tied at one set each going into the break.

The Wildcats came out with a little more fight in them in the third set gaining a little momentum by going on a 6-1 run in the middle of the set. It wasn't enough and WSU couldn't dig themselves out of the point deficit dropping the third set 25-19.

The fourth set was a fight to the finish for both teams. With the scored tied at 13-13 and after rotational errors and confusion the Wildcats went on to score the next five points including a kill from Tanisha Langston and another from Hannah Hill and a pair of big blocks by Andrea Hale and Hill and another by Langston and Hill. In the end the Hornets ended the set with a kill by Kennedy Kurtz giving Sac State the 25-23 fourth set victory and overall 3-1 match victory.

Weber State was led by Andrea Hale who had 10 kills off 26 attacks for a .269 percentage. This was Hale's first time having double figure kills this season. Jesse Hover ended the night with 29 digs. Thamires Cavalcanti added 15 digs. Bailey Irwin had a double double on the night rocking 11 digs and 37 assists.

Megan Thompson had seven blocks on the night including one solo.

Weber State had better defensive stats then Sac State with 83 digs and 26 blocks to Sac State's 78 digs and 14 blocks. The Hornet's had 59 kills and 182 attacks for a .170 percentage on the night and WSU hit 41 kills off 156 attacks for .135 percentage on the night. The Wildcats did have 20 hitting errors to the Hornets 28.

Weber State is now 9-1 overall on the season and 0-1 in Big Sky Conference play. The Wildcats will host Portland State tomorrow night before hitting the road to Southern Utah and Northern Arizona.
